Barcelona loanee wanted on a permanent deal by Serie A club

Photo by Xavier Laine/Getty Images

Barcelona defender Samuel Umtiti continues to impress within Italy. Currently, on loan from the Catalans, he has thus far played his football this season for Serie A side Lecce, a side where he has cemented himself as one of the starters and first names on the side’s team sheets.

Courtesy of his consistency for Lecce, the Italian side are currently trying to materialize a permanent move for the French defender or alternatively extend the duration of his stay be it through an extension of his current loan deal with the club.

Following a massively detrimental series of knee complications, Samuel Umtiti had been out of favor within the defensive hierarchy of FC Barcelona and found himself more often than not warming the benches at the Spanish club. But the move to Italy has been substantially beneficial to the defender’s career, as Lecce themselves now wish to keep him there and reports from Mundo Deportivo suggest the player would prefer to stay at the Italian club for the near foreseeable future.

Pantaleo Corvino, sports director of Lecce. had the following to say regarding Lecce’s intentions with the FC Barcelona defender:

“When you arrive in Serie A in your first year you have to try to create the right mix, a cocktail of experience and youth. For a coach, it is a very important aspect and the arrival of Umtiti responds to this need. In the Umtiti operation, we achieved it and we hope that in the future there may be others. Let’s see if we have the go-ahead from Barça and the player… If we have the go-ahead from both, that can be explored. In summer, Umtiti already had the will to choose Lecce.”

Should the player choose to stay at Lecce, it would be an understandable decision, given that he himself is aware that he may not receive neither much importance nor minutes should he return to the Catalan club. How this saga develops is currently yet to be seen in accordance with what FC Barcelona themselves deem fit.
